## Runbook: Turnstile Counter Stall (Harrowfield Arena)

If gate counts freeze on the Gatewing dashboard: check the aggregator first, not the turnstiles. Restart the `gatewing-agg` service on the venue edge box; counts backfill from device buffers within two minutes. If backfill fails, devices hold 30 minutes of events — do not power-cycle turnstiles during entry rush. Escalate if the gap exceeds 10 minutes. Confirm the edge box is running the approved release, identified by the token below.

pipeline stamp: htk9_ce63042d9

Reduce GC pause spikes in the Pairwell matching service. Long-lived candidate pools were promoting to old gen and triggering full collections every ~40 minutes, stalling match latency p99 past 2s. This PR switches the pool to an off-heap ring buffer and caps young-gen churn by reusing scorer scratch arrays. No behavior change to match output; verified against the Delverton replay suite. Tuning constants chosen from the soak run are as follows.

constants for yagef-yajep:
WEIGHTS = {
    "ralael": 172,
    "fraok": 62,
    "silath": 622,
    "druox": 279,
    "julax": 87,
    "gileth": 217,
    "ralion": 397,
}

Q: Why does Seamcheck block SQL files with string-concatenated identifiers? A: Concatenation patterns are the most common injection vector we've found in Harkvale's codebase, so the rule errs toward false positives. Suppressions require a justification comment and are audited quarterly by the security guild. The complete rule catalogue, severity tiers, and the suppression review process are documented on the page below.

dashboard of yafog-fajof = https://jira.tolvaqsys.internal/pages/pages/projects/49fe21c4

HANDOVER — Pella to next on-call, Brightstand kiosk fleet

The watchdog on the Brightstand kiosk app is currently in degraded mode after Tuesday's firmware push. It still restarts hung sessions, but the heartbeat to the Ostermill console reports stale timestamps, so ignore the red banner until the fix ships Thursday. If a kiosk fully wedges, use the local maintenance shell rather than a remote reboot. To unlock the shell's recovery mode, enter the passphrase that follows.

strongbox words: norwyn-wenael-aldvan-aldiel-wendor-holael